ALGORITHM OF THE SELECTION OF CONCEPTS WITH THE HELP OF A SYNTACTIC TABLE,

Abstract

The method of machine translation described in this article concerns the principles of organization in algorithmic language (in this case in the (ALGOL-60)) and are calculated basically for small machines. However, they can be used in multipass translators. It is natural in the structure of the translator to separate the part realizing the syntax of the language and the part realizing its sematics. In connection with this there was selected the following structure of the translator: (a) the syntax of the language is assigned a special syntactic table; (b) the semantics of the language is assigned a library of subprograms such as each syntactic unit of the language (metavariable) corresponds to its 'semantic' subprogram; (c) the operation of the translator is ensured by a certain control program, which consecutively (one by one) selects the basic symbols of the language from the recording of the algorithm, turns their sequences, according to the syntactic table into increasingly enveloping syntactic units and with the selection of each unit turns to the corresponding semantic subprogram; in other words, in a given control program the algorithm of the selection of concepts is realized.
